Swissquote, established in 1996, stands as a well-established online broker and bank, publicly traded on a stock exchange. It holds a remarkable Trust Score of 99 out of 99 according to ForexBrokers.com, signifying a high level of trust. Swissquote is distinguished by its regulatory strength, boasting five Tier-1 licenses and two Tier-2 licenses, which are indicators of high and trusted levels of security and oversight in the industry.
In contrast, ACY Securities, founded in 2011, operates privately and does not hold a bank status. It possesses a Trust Score of 75, indicating an average risk rating according to ForexBrokers.com. When it comes to regulatory credentials, ACY Securities holds one Tier-1 license, providing a level of security assurance, albeit not as extensive as Swissquote's. With no Tier-2 licenses, ACY Securities positions itself differently in the reliability landscape compared to its counterpart Swissquote.

When comparing Swissquote and ACY Securities regarding commissions and fees, each broker presents unique offerings tailored to various trader profiles. Swissquote's primary allure lies in its strong institutional backing from a Swiss banking conglomerate, though this comes with a premium. The U.K. division of Swissquote offers relatively lower costs starting from a commission of $5 per round-turn trade on its Elite account, targeted at active traders with at least a $10,000 deposit. Both its Luxembourg and Swiss branches offer multiple accounts with minimum deposits ranging from $1,000 to $50,000, featuring spreads from 0.6 pips to 1.7 pips depending on the account type. Swissquote earns a 3.5-star rating for commissions and fees and is ranked #53 out of 63 brokers by ForexBrokers.com.
In contrast, ACY Securities focuses on flexibility and competitive pricing, appealing to both small-scale and high-volume traders. With a commission-free Standard account requiring a deposit of just $50, it offers average spreads of 1.2 pips on EUR/USD. For more seasoned investors, ProZero and Bespoke accounts offer more competitive conditions, with spreads narrowing to 0.25 pips, although these accounts come with higher deposit thresholds starting at $200 and $10,000 respectively. The commissions vary and can be as low as $3 per round trip for Australian residents using the ProZero account. ACY Securities boasts a solid 4.5-star rating for its fees, positioning it at #21 in ForexBrokers.com's rankings.
Overall, while Swissquote provides the reassurance and prestige of banking with a Swiss giant, this comes with higher trading costs. Conversely, ACY Securities is more accessible for new traders with lower entry barriers, while also offering cost advantages for volume traders. Both brokers cater to different needs and priorities, as reflected in their respective ratings and rankings for commissions and fees.

Swissquote and ACY Securities both cater to forex enthusiasts, offering trading in this popular asset class. While Swissquote provides 80 tradeable forex pairs, ACY Securities has a slightly smaller selection with 66 pairs. However, ACY shines in the total number of tradeable symbols, offering a significant variety with 2,200 options compared to Swissquote's 472. Despite the smaller number of symbols, Swissquote compensates by allowing its clients to invest in exchange traded securities on both U.S. and international exchanges, a feature ACY Securities does not provide. This enables Swissquote users to directly purchase stocks such as Apple and Vodafone, enhancing investment opportunities beyond forex and CFDs.
For those interested in cryptocurrency, Swissquote offers more options as users can buy both actual cryptocurrencies and cryptocurrency derivatives. ACY Securities, on the other hand, limits its offerings to cryptocurrency derivatives only. Both platforms support copy trading for users looking to mirror the trades of successful investors. In terms of overall range of investments, Swissquote holds a higher rank and rating, securing 5 stars and a #2 position out of 63 brokers according to ForexBrokers.com. ACY Securities is rated 4 stars and ranks #30, highlighting Swissquote's broader and more flexible investment options.

Swissquote and ACY Securities both offer comprehensive trading platforms with features designed to cater to traders of all levels. Both brokers provide free virtual demo accounts, allowing users to practice and refine their trading strategies without any financial risk. They each have proprietary platforms developed in-house and also offer industry standards like MetaTrader 4 and 5, along with web-based browser options and Windows desktop platforms. For those interested in social trading, both brokers support copy trading, though neither offers integration with popular services like DupliTrade or ZuluTrade.
When it comes to trading tools, Swissquote seems to have a slight edge. They offer a higher number of drawing tools for charting with 75 options compared to ACY Securities' 15. Swissquote also provides more customization with up to 11 fields available for creating watch lists, while ACY Securities offers seven. Both brokers enable trading directly from stock charts, making transactions more seamless. With these features combined, Swissquote scores 4.5 out of 5 stars from ForexBrokers.com for its trading platforms and tools, while ACY Securities garners a respectable 4-star rating. Swissquote is ranked at #12 among 63 brokers in this category, whereas ACY Securities holds the #41 position.

When comparing the mobile trading apps of Swissquote and ACY Securities, both platforms are equipped with essential features like iPhone and Android compatibility, stock or forex price alerts, and the ability to draw trendlines and view multiple time frames on charts. They both provide 30 technical studies for charting and offer the convenience of creating watchlists with real-time quotes. However, neither app allows users to sync watchlist symbols with their online accounts, which may be a consideration for some traders.
In terms of user ratings and rankings, Swissquote edges ahead with a Mobile Trading Apps rating of 4.5 stars, compared to ACY Securitiesโ 4 stars. Swissquote also holds a higher position in the ForexBrokers.com ranking, coming in at #12 out of 63 brokers, while ACY Securities takes the #40 spot. These distinctions may influence traders looking for a highly rated mobile trading experience, where Swissquote seems to hold a slight advantage in overall user satisfaction and industry recognition.

When comparing the market research offerings of Swissquote and ACY Securities, both brokers provide daily market commentary to keep traders informed. However, Swissquote stands out by delivering forex news from prominent sources like Bloomberg, Reuters, and Dow Jones, while ACY Securities does not. Swissquote also supports traders with technical tools from Autochartist, enhancing their analytical capabilities, which is not the case with ACY Securities. However, neither broker offers tools from Trading Central or sentiment-based trading tools. That said, both provide an economic calendar to keep traders abreast of global economic events.
Swissquote's superior offerings reflect in its higher research rating of four stars compared to ACY Securities' 3.5 stars. According to ForexBrokers.com, Swissquote ranks as the 16th best broker out of 63 for research, overshadowing ACY Securities, which holds the 45th position. These distinctions make Swissquote a more attractive option for traders seeking comprehensive market research and updates backed by renowned information providers and analysis tools.

When comparing Swissquote and ACY Securities for beginner-focused educational resources, both online brokers provide ample learning materials for those new to forex and CFDs. Each platform offers more than ten educational pieces, such as articles, videos, and webinars, which cater to individuals looking to get started in trading. Additionally, both Swissquote and ACY Securities host monthly webinars with archived recordings available, making it easy for users to access past sessions anytime.
Swissquote has a slight edge over ACY Securities when it comes to educational resources. They offer educational videos for both beginners and advanced traders, whereas ACY Securities focuses primarily on beginner-level content. Furthermore, Swissquote provides an investor dictionary with over 50 investing terms, a feature not available with ACY Securities. This added breadth of resources is reflected in their higher educational rating of 4 stars, compared to ACY Securities' 3.5 stars. According to ForexBrokers.com, Swissquote ranks significantly higher in the education category, placing 21st out of 63 brokers, while ACY Securities holds the 43rd position.
